Rapper YNW Melly Could Potentially Face Death Penalty

Lorraine O'Connor • Apr 22, 2019

YNW Melly's life is in some serious trouble! The State of Florida is seeking death penalty for the rapper's murder case.

YNW Melly is currently charged with two counts of first-degree murder. The Police have stated that the rapper shot his two friends, Anthony Williams and Christopher Thomas Jr., in the head, torso and back during October 2018. Cops believe the rapper had the crime scene staged like a drive-by shooting by shooting his own car.

According to TMZ, legal documents are saying that the State is pushing for death penalty against Melly.

Additionally, the state also believes that, "it can prove beyond a reasonable doubt that Melly killed his friends for financial gain, the murder was especially heinous, atrocious or cruel, and he committed homicide in a cold, calculated and premeditated manner." Officials also think that Melly is a criminal gang member.
